What they do

A Collections Analyst communicates with clients to provide support and follows up on outstanding payments. Prepares and reviews reports about collection accounts and monitors collection of over-due accounts. May also analyze credit risk and recommend credit extension.

Job Description

We are looking for a Collections Specialist to support payment recovery efforts and maintain healthy customer accounts in Wyomissing, Pennsylvania. This Long-term Contract position is ideal for someone who can balance professionalism and persistence while working with overdue accounts across a variety of collection situations. The person in this role will communicate with customers, evaluate delinquency trends, and help improve cash flow through timely follow-up and accurate reporting.
Responsibilities:
  • Manage a daily queue of overdue accounts, setting priorities and reaching out to customers by phone and in writing to secure payment in line with agreed terms.
  • Coordinate with customers to establish practical repayment arrangements, obtaining leadership approval when exceptions or adjusted plans are needed.
  • Produce regular collection and aging reports that highlight delinquent balances, emerging risk patterns, and account status updates for stakeholders.
  • Assess troubled accounts and suggest when external recovery agencies should be engaged for further pursuit.
  • Support cash recovery goals by maintaining consistent follow-up activity and contributing to team and business performance targets.
  • Communicate clearly with internal partners and external customers to resolve payment issues, clarify balances, and document outcomes.
  • Assist with additional accounting-related reporting and special projects connected to receivables management as needed.
